IntrospectionResponse
public IntrospectionResponse(boolean active, @Nullable @Nullable String tokenType, @Nullable @Nullable String scope, @Nullable @Nullable String clientId, @Nullable @Nullable String username, @Nullable @Nullable Long exp, @Nullable @Nullable Long iat, @Nullable @Nullable Long nbf, @Nullable @Nullable String sub, @Nullable @Nullable String aud, @Nullable @Nullable String iss, @Nullable @Nullable String jti, @Nullable @Nullable Map<String, Object> extensions) - Parameters:
 active- Boolean indicator of whether or not the presented token is currently active.tokenType- Type of token.scope- A JSON string containing a space-separated list of scopes associated with this token.clientId- Client identifier for the OAuth 2.0 client that requested this token.username- Human-readable identifier for the resource owner who authorized this token.exp- Integer timestamp, measured in the number of seconds since January 1 1970 UTC, indicating when this token will expire as defined in JWT.iat- Integer timestamp, measured in the number of seconds since January 1 1970 UTC, indicating when this token was originally issued, as defined in JWT.nbf- Integer timestamp, measured in the number of seconds since January 1 1970 UTC, indicating when this token is not to be used before, as defined in JWT.sub- Subject of the token, as defined in JWT [RFC7519]. Usually a machine-readable identifier of the resource owner who authorized this token.aud- Service-specific string identifier or list of string identifiers representing the intended audience for this token, as defined in JWT.iss- String representing the issuer of this token, as defined in JWT.jti- String identifier for the token, as defined in JWT.extensions- Extensions
